7 Deal-Saving Gadgets for Agents on the Go

There’s a long list of things that can kill or delay any part of a real estate transaction.

Clients understand when factors, like the weather, delay a deal. But, for everything else they want you to have a solution. That includes having the tech you need to do business from anywhere.

When it comes to real estate tech, portability is king. Here’s a list of smart spends from the cutting edge for 2013 that will help you ensure technology never stands between you and closing a deal.

Options for Extending Your Battery Life

Forget worrying about a battery drain leaving you out in the field with a lifeless cell phone, tablet, or laptop. These tax-deductible options from this year’s, Consumer Electronics Show, are great for making sure your devices stay alive.

1. Mobile Electric Generator With Two Weeks of Power

The Nectar mobile power source is a great options for agents who want to roam free of wall outlets.

The fuel cell cartridge technology from Lilliputian System can be used to power Smartphones, tablets, Bluetooth headsets, digital cameras, and more. In addition, the cartridge is touted as boosting the run-times on mobile devices by ten times more than a traditional charge.

The Good News: This charging cartridge will be a lifesaver for office-less agents

The Bad News: You’ll have to wait until the summer and pay $299.99 to get it.

To pre-order yours, visit Nectar Power online.

2. Rob Your Tablet to Charge Your Phone With Device-to-Device Chargers

The way you charge your devices while on the go is about to undergo a radical change.

At the Consumer Electronics Show, Fulton Innovation debuted a new technology its still developing that can do wireless charging device-to-device. “eCoupled two-way wireless power” works by placing devices back-to-back to transfer power wirelessly between them.

For example, if your Smartphone was running low on power, you could place it on top of your tablet and harness power from your tablet to charge up. Watch this video to see how it works.

The Good News: With this technology charging will become a ton easier.

The Bad News: We scoured the Web and could not find a release date for this new tech tool.

Accident-Proof Essentials

If you work in an area that experiences rain, sleet, and snow your devices are bound to run into the risk of damage. And, if you’re not, for some agents your purse or briefcase can be a dangerous zone in between listing appointments.

Here are two agent essentials that are up to the test, no matter what environment they run into.

3. The “Survivor” Style Camera for Listing Photos

If you need a rugged camera, the Olympus’ Tough TG-2 iHS is being touted as one of the industry’s best heavy-duty options. The 12-megapixel camera not only shoots HD videos but it’s also

    • waterproof in up to 50 feet underwater,
    • freeze-proof down to 14 degrees Fahrenheit,
    • crush-proof up to 220 pounds, and
    • it won’t break from drops from lower than 6 feet.

The Good News: This camera hits the market just as many of your tax returns will come in – March 2013.

The Bad News: To get the best, you’ll pay a pretty hefty price at $380.

4. A Smartphone That Swims

If you need a hardier Smartphone, Sony also debuted the Xperia Z at the CES this year. This 4G LTE, Android Smartphone can withstand dunks in up to three feet of water. You’ll never have to worry about a coffee or any other spill ruining your phone again.

The Good News: Rumor is this phone will hit the market in the next few weeks.

The Bad News: The cost for this device is still under wraps.

High Accessibility

5. Hard Drive in Your Pocket

If you’re opposed to cloud-based services for storing documents, consider carrying some heavy-duty storage that’s easily transportable on your key ring.

With the Kingston DataTraveler HyperX Predator 3.0 you can bring practically every document you have with you on a device the size of your thumb.

This is way more than normal “thumb drive” with up to 1TB storage on a USB flash drive (double that of most laptops).

The Good News: You can keep HD movies of your listings and photos and retrieve them at super-fast speeds wherever you go with “the world’s largest capacity flash drive,” according to the company.

The Bad News: Again, we have no idea how much this one will cost.

6. Double-Duty Tablet-PC Devices

This year, you don’t have to make the “tablet vs. laptop” decision when it comes to buys for your business. Tech companies are rolling out more all-in-one devices that lighten the load in your briefcase.

Our pick to check out from this year’s CES is the Asus Transformer AIO P1801. It’s a PC that features an 18.4-inch display screen, but also transform into a tablet by removing the screen when you need it.

The Good News: It features dual OSes — Windows 8 and Android 4.1 Jellybean for just $1,299.

The Bad News: There isn’t any as long as you don’t mind having a widescreen on the go.

7. Battery-Saving Dual Display Smartphone

Another multi-purpose device debuting at CES this year: A prototype of the YotaPhone, a 9mm, Android 4.1 Jellybean Smartphone that has an e-ink display on the back.

What’s “e-ink?” E-ink displays won’t drain a charge. They mirror anything displayed on the main, HD, display screen to save you major battery life.

The Good: You’ll be able to read a lengthy article or contract without burning your Smartphone’s battery life.

The Bad: You’ll have to wait to at least September to do it.
